网站安全防护与响应式设计实战精要
|
作为前端开发者,我们每天都在与代码打交道,但安全和响应式设计往往是被忽视的两个关键点。网站的安全防护不只是后端的责任,前端同样需要承担起责任,比如防止XSS攻击、处理用户输入时的过滤、使用HTTPS等。 在响应式设计方面,我们需要从移动端优先的角度出发,利用媒体查询、弹性布局和flexbox来实现多设备适配。同时,图片和资源的加载策略也至关重要,懒加载和图片压缩可以显著提升性能和用户体验。
本AI图示为示意用途,仅供参考 安全防护不能只停留在表面,比如对表单提交的数据进行严格的校验,避免恶意脚本注入。同时,合理设置CSP(内容安全策略)也能有效防止跨站脚本攻击,增强网站的整体安全性。在实际开发中,我们可以借助一些工具和库来简化安全和响应式的实现,比如Lodash用于数据处理,Vue或React的组件化结构有助于维护代码的可读性和可扩展性。同时,自动化测试也是不可或缺的一环,确保每次更新都不会破坏原有的功能和安全性。 响应式设计不仅仅是让页面在不同设备上显示正常,更重要的是提供一致的用户体验。这意味着我们需要关注字体大小、按钮点击区域、导航结构等细节,让每个用户都能顺畅地操作。 安全和响应式设计不是一蹴而就的,而是持续优化的过程。定期审查代码、更新依赖库、监控网站性能和安全状况,才能确保我们的项目始终处于最佳状态。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330469号